Join us this week as we continue an extended study through 2 Corinthians, centering on the themes of comfort and affliction. Addressing the doctrine of suffering, we see that suffering draws believers closer to God, teaching reliance on His strength over self. Comfort, as the other side of the same coin, is grounded in God's faithfulness, His promises, and restorative forgiveness among believers. Through the example of Paul’s dealings with the Corinthian church, we are called to pursue confession, extend forgiveness, build restoration, and cling to the eternal hope of God's victory through Christ. True comfort is found in God's character and His unchanging promises.
